This is the best Brat Pack movie, it’s about a group of very different people who meet in detention. They are forced to spend a whole day together and things get very interesting. The group of students is composed of two girls and three guys. John Bender “the criminal” (played by Judd Nelson) he is kind of like a delinquent or a hoodlum but he is misguided and come from a very abusing family witch would most likely explain his behaviour. Claire Standish “the princess” (played by Molly Ringwald) she is the typical popular snoby teen who goes along with whatever the popular kids do. Andrew Clark “the athlete” (played by Emilio Estevez) he is also just a typical jock who hangs with his jock friends and picks on the weak, but he is also very pressured by his father to be the best at everything. Allison Reynolds “the basketcase” (played by Ally Sheedy) she is dark and more of a loner, caused by the ignorance of her parents. Brian Johnson “the nerd” (played by Anthony Michael Hall) he’s a typical nerd who is obsessed with his grades, witch is caused by the pressure put on by his parents. The Breakfast club is a great movie about life in high school it really demonstrates the act of different social groups and the differences between people. Although this film is very good and very entertaining it also shows that you shouldn’t judge people by their social standards and looks because you never know what you can find in a person. A few interesting facts: In the year 2000, the school in witch they shot the film was turned into a police station. The film was set in the fictional town of Shermer, IL, but was actually filmed in Northbrook, IL.
